K000663 is an FDA 510(k) clearance for the KRONNER LOW PROFILE SCOPE HOLDER. Classified as Laparoscope, General & Plastic Surgery (product code GCJ), Class II - Special Controls.

Submitted by Kronner Prototypes, Inc. (Roseburg, US). The FDA issued a Cleared decision on May 2, 2000 after a review of 64 days - a notably fast clearance cycle.

This device falls under the General & Plastic Surgery FDA review panel, regulated under 21 CFR 876.1500 - the FDA general and plastic surgery device framework. The Traditional 510(k) pathway establishes clearance through subst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device, without requiring clinical trial data.
